Book Synopsis The Bridge at Remagen by : Ken Hechler

Download or read book The Bridge at Remagen written by Ken Hechler and published by Presidio Press. This book was released on 1957 with total page 268 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This blow-by-blow account tells the true story of the capture of the Ludendorff Bridge that crossed the Rhine--a successful mission that saved thousands of American lives and spearheaded the invasion of Nazi Germany.
